Based on the provided figures, we are analyzing a solid slab of thickness and thermal conductivity . Under steady-state conditions, the heat conducted through the slab from Surface 1 (at temperature ) to Surface 2 (at temperature ) must balance the heat lost from Surface 2 to the environment via convection and radiation.
